Julienne refers to the foods that are cut in long, thin strips. Julienne is a culinary term which is usually associated with a particular cut of vegetables, but may be applied to cooked meat or fish which are often used as garnishing or in soups

Julienne also means to cut food into long, thin or match-like strips about 3 mm (millimeter) wide and 4 to 5 centimeters long

Japchae refers to Korean glutinous sweet potato noodles mixed with stir-fried vegetables, beef or seafood.

Jew's Mallow Leaves is another name of Moloukhiya, a green leafy vegetables, like spinach or chard that is used to make the Egyptian popular green soup called Moloukhiya.

Jägerschnitzel refers to a German dish which is a cutlet with mushroom sauce
Jebne is an Arabic white cheese
